A law firm in New York City, NY is seeking a Joint Ventures Associate Attorney with 3-6 years of experience in handling complex and sophisticated real estate joint ventures. The candidate will work on drafting and negotiating real estate limited liability company (LLC) and partnership agreements, providing expert legal counsel in the area of real estate joint ventures. The ideal candidate will have a strong academic record, excellent communication skills, and major law firm experience. A tax LL.M. or familiarity with partnership tax is a plus. The candidate must be admitted to the New York State Bar.
